BEPS Pillar Two — Global Minimum Tax

The global minimum tax at 15% continues to reshape cross-border tax planning. Over 40 jurisdictions have enacted QDMTT. HK and SG both have domestic top-up tax effective FY2025.

CRS 2.0 & CARF

67 jurisdictions committed to implement CARF by 2028. Crypto holdings previously outside CRS scope will become reportable — DeFi staking, NFTs, tokenized assets all captured.

AI Tax Analysis
1. Key Changes: Hong Kong is implementing a comprehensive automatic exchange framework for cryptocurrency assets, aligning with global Common Reporting Standards. The amendments require mandatory reporting of crypto transactions by service providers, enhanced due diligence procedures, and new disclosure requirements for taxpayers holding digital assets. The changes appear retroactive to some extent, covering transactions since 2022. 2. Compliance Risks: Family offices with crypto holdings face significant compliance exposure. Failure to properly report crypto transactions could result in substantial penalties, including back taxes, interest, and fines. The complexity of tracking crypto transactions across multiple platforms and jurisdictions creates substantial documentation challenges. The broad definition of "crypto assets" may catch family offices unaware of their reporting obligations. 3. Recommended Actions: Conduct immediate inventory of all crypto holdings across all family entities. Engage qualified tax professionals to determine reporting obligations for historical transactions. Implement robust record-keeping systems for all crypto activities. Review all service provider agreements to ensure compliance with new reporting requirements. Consider voluntary disclosure if past reporting was incomplete. Develop ongoing monitoring procedures to ensure future compliance with evolving regulations.
